As a conventional technology for floats used for floating fishing nets, there is one described in Japanese Utility Model Publication No. 154488/1988. This float has a structure in which the surface layer is a hard skin layer that is denser than the inner layer, and the air bubbles are smaller from the surface toward the inside, so the dense surface layer can prevent water from seeping into the inside. This has the advantage of preventing a decrease in buoyancy. Furthermore, since the surface layer is hard, there is also the advantage that wear resistance and pressure resistance can be improved.

However, since the inner layer is highly foamed and has low strength, the inner peripheral surface of the rope insertion hole is likely to wear out due to contact with the rope inserted into the center rope insertion hole.
When hauling fishing nets using a net-lifting machine, bending stress is concentrated at both ends of the rope insertion hole, so there is a disadvantage that cracks occur at the ends of the rope insertion hole, making it easy to break.

In order to solve the above problems, this invention provides end tubes made of non-foamed synthetic resin at both ends of the rope insertion hole, and gradually increases the thickness of the end tube toward the opening of the rope insertion hole. The wall is thick, and a protrusion is provided on the inner circumferential surface of the outer end of the end tube.

As mentioned above, by providing the end tubes at both ends of the rope insertion hole, it is possible to prevent the inner peripheral surface of the rope insertion hole from being worn out due to contact with the rope, and also to prevent the inner peripheral surface of the rope insertion hole from being worn out due to contact with the rope. Since the stress in is applied to the protrusion, it is possible to prevent cracking or damage at both ends of the rope insertion hole.

The manufacturing method disclosed in Publication No. 2235 can be adopted. That is, pre-formed end tubes 4 are set on both ends of the core rod, both ends of which are supported by the mold, or both ends of the core rod are covered with non-foamed synthetic resin, while the mold is A low-foaming material is applied to the inner periphery to form an outer layer of the required thickness, and a high-foaming material is filled inside the outer layer, and the low-foaming material and high-foaming material are pre-foamed by applying pressure and heating. It is taken out from the mold and subjected to secondary heating to cause secondary foaming.
